理解基础知识:
学习数字电路基础:了解二进制数、逻辑门、触发器等基础知识。
掌握微控制器(MCU)的基本概念和原理。
学习PSOC芯片架构:
了解PSOC芯片的基本架构和工作原理。
掌握PSOC的主要组件,如可编程逻辑块(PLB)、可编程数字I/O块(DIOB)等。
掌握开发环境:
学习并熟悉PSOC Creator开发环境,这是开发PSOC芯片的主要工具。
了解如何设置项目、添加组件、配置参数等。
学习编程语言:
PSOC支持多种编程语言,如C、C++和汇编语言。选择一种你熟悉的或感兴趣的语言,并开始编程实践。
实践项目:
通过实践项目来加深对PSOC的理解和应用。可以从简单的LED闪烁项目开始,逐渐过渡到更复杂的项目。
阅读官方文档和教程:
PSOC的官方文档和教程是非常宝贵的资源,可以帮助你解决遇到的问题并深入了解技术细节。
加入社区和论坛:
加入相关的技术社区和论坛,与其他PSOC用户交流,分享经验和技巧,解决问题。
持续学习和跟进:
PSOC技术不断发展,持续关注最新的技术动态、新产品和教程,保持学习的热情。
从简单到复杂:
不要一开始就试图解决一个非常复杂的问题。先从简单的例子入手,然后逐步增加复杂性。这样更容易理解和掌握技术。
耐心和毅力:
学习新技术需要时间和耐心。遇到困难时,不要轻易放弃,持续努力并寻求帮助,你会逐渐掌握PSOC的奥秘。
|